At Busy Bees Ōtāhuhu, we see every child as a unique and special taonga. Located in the heart of our community, our centre is a vibrant, multi-cultural hub where tamariki are empowered to become active, confident learners. We are currently looking for a passionate and dedicated Teacher to join our whānau on a fixed-term basis until June 2026.

About us: Life at Ōtāhuhu is a beautiful blend of cozy indoor discovery and big outdoor adventures. Our centre is designed with three distinct spaces that honor every developmental milestone, from the trust-led bonds of our Nursery to the independence-seeking world of our Preschoolers. We are proud holders of the Healthy Heart Award, meaning the inviting smell of home-cooked "Nourish" meals is a constant in our hallway. Whether we are exploring Papatūānuku in our shared garden or heading out on a local excursion to the library, we are deeply committed to our community and the diverse cultures that make our whānau so special. As part of the Busy Bees Aotearoa whānau, we are backed by a national network that brings global expertise, extensive professional development, and a deep commitment to high-quality education.

About you: You bring a warm, approachable energy and a genuine passion for the early years, whether you are beginning your ECE studies or bringing valuable life experience to our team. We are looking for a kaiako who demonstrates initiative and a proactive "can-do" spirit, someone who is excited to engage in open-ended play and critical thinking alongside our tamariki. You communicate with clarity and heart, building trusting relationships with whānau and colleagues alike. Most importantly, you act with integrity and are eager to grow your practice within a supportive, collaborative environment.

Our centres are located across the length of New Zealand, from Coopers Beach in Northland, all the way to Oamaru in Southland, and all offer something unique and special to their local communities.

It is people that are at the heart of everything we do, and as an organisation, we are passionate about providing the best care and early childhood education for the next generation of New Zealanders. We see each child as unique, and work closely with our families and communities to create meaningful, engaging and fun learning experiences for each child. We’re dedicated to supporting our tamariki to thrive and reach their full potential in their life-long learning journey.

At Busy Bees Aotearoa, we believe that our team are vital to the success of the business, delivering on our values and providing the best quality care to our children and parents.

Each member of the team plays a vital role in the development of the children at their individual early learning centre, and we strive to bring out the best in all our staff by providing them with the support and tools they need to succeed.
